With 3200 MHz memory, the server supports a 3200 MHz memory bus speed at 1 DIMM per channel (DPC) and 2933 MHz at 2 DPC. The server supports a total of up to 9 PCIe 4.0 slots (8 with rear access, 1 internal for a RAID adapter or HBA) plus a dedicated OCP 3.0 SFF slot for networking.
